The claimant must prove:  (1) the original bid or estimate was reasonable; (2) the amounts expended by the claimant for performing the additional work were reasonable; (3) any excess amounts were due to the defendants; and (4) no alternative method of computing damages is possible. The First District Court of Appeal, in Commercial Mechanical Co. v. State for Use and Benefit of American Air Filter Co., held that where there was no liquidated damages clause in the subcontract, but the contractor’s agreement contained such a clause, the subcontractor could not be laibel for payment of the liquidated damages even if it was responsible for the delay.
